Filius Flitwick


 

Filius Flitwick (born October 17, year unknown)http://www.mugglenet.com/jkrcom/birthdayarchive.shtml is a fictional character in the Harry Potter books. Flitwick is the Charms professor and head of Ravenclaw househttp://www.jkrowling.com/textonly/faq_view.cfm?id=15 at Hogwarts. It is rumoured that Flitwick was dueling champion when he was younger. Flitwick took part in the insurrection against Dolores Umbridge and is known to empathise with "half-breeds", such as Hagrid, due to the fact Flitwick himself is part goblinhttp://www.jkrowling.com/textonly/faq_view.cfm?id=95. As such, he is very short and requires a stack of books in order to see over the top of his desk. He has white hair and taught at Hogwarts when James Potter and company were there. It is possible that he will replace Minerva McGonagall as Deputy Head of Hogwarts.

In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ince, Filius is summoned by Minerva McGonagall to ask Professor Severus Snape to come to the aid of the Order of the Phoenix against the Death Eaters. Unfortunately, Snape stupefied Flitwick, joined the Death Eaters, and ended up killing (former) Headmaster Albus Dumbledore. (Battle of Hogwarts)

The name "Flitwick" could be derived from the name of the town of Flitwick near London (though that name is pronounced "Flittick"), or it could be a combination of "flit" (that is, to move quickly and lightly) and "wick" (a word from Northern England meaning "lively.") Filius is the Latin word for "son".

Warwick Davis played Flitwick in the first two films. He also played the goblin bank teller in the first film. He will return in his role for the fourth movie, Harry Potter and the Goblet of Fire.
